Ensiled cassava leaves supplemented with palm oil (Elaeis guineensis), broken rice and dried fish for growing pigs

Chhay Ty

University of Tropical Agriculture Foundation
Chamcar Daung, Phnom Penh, Cambodia 

Hypothesis

Mr Chhay Ty will test the hypothesis that: Growth rates, digestibility and N retention in pigs fed ensiled cassava leaves will increase when palm oil and broken rice are added to the diet.

 

Experimental plan

There are 2 experiments. The first experiment is “Evaluation of the digestibility and N retention by pigs fed cassava silage supplemented with either broken rice or a mixture of palm oil, broken rice,  and with different levels of dried fish. This experiment uses 4 castrated male crossbreed piglets with an initial body weight of 10 according to a balanced 4*4 Latin square arrangement, with the following treatments:

·        P0: Cassava silage + Broken rice +fish meal

·        P5: Cassava silage+ Broken rice+ palm oil (5%) + fish meal

·        P10: Cassava silage+ Broken rice+ palm oil (10%) +fish meal

·        P5: Cassava silage+ Broken rice+ palm oil (15%) + fish meal

Measurement is of digestibility of DM, OM and N and the N retention. 

The second experiment is “Performance of growing pigs fed ensiled cassava leaves supplemented with broken rice or a mixture of palm oil and broken rice and different levels of dried fish”. In this experiment are 8 females and 8 males with initial body weight of 10 to 15kg.  The design is a comparison of 4 dietary treatments (the same as in experiment 1) and 2 sexes according to a factorial arrangement 4*2 with 2 replications.  Measurements are of growth, feed conversion and carcass quality.
